What must one do to get a no wake buoy placed?
A new development (White Oak) is being built at the end of our small slough, with at least 30 new homes planned, more than doubling the boat traffic.

This should generate a lot of responses........ As I understand it, only the Marine Police can put up an "official" No Wake marker. Several were put up by individuals and when the MP see them I understand they will remove them. Not sure what the criteria is for placing one, but they seem to be few and far between so I suspect it is fairly limited.

My suggestion is that once the homes start to sell that you create a flyer to put at each of the houses suggesting courteous boat operation. My guess is that will solve most of the problems.
